Sri Lankan Police Arrested Kuwaiti Couple For Assaulting Customs Officials

29 July 2018 Crime News

Sri Lankan police on Friday arrested a Kuwaiti couple accused of assault which left five Customs officers injured and in the hospital as they tried to stop the couple from smuggling a pet dog, officials said.

A 32-year-old woman and her 29-year-old partner, both Kuwaitis, turned violent when they were informed about the quarantine regulations and tried to flee from Colombo airport with the animal, police and customs agents said. “A female Customs officer was badly hurt after she was attacked by the Kuwaiti woman,” a customs spokesman told AFP.

“Four other Customs officers were injured when they tried to stop the couple from attacking people. All five have been hospitalized,” the spokesman added.

Airport police disclosed they had never recorded such a case before. Police said the Kuwaiti couple are being held at a police station near the airport and will appear before a magistrate on Saturday. Sri Lanka imposes quarantine rules on pets brought into the island country (AFP).
